Frequently Asked Questions about French Camp
How much are Studio apartments in French Camp?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in French Camp with rent ranges from $1,000 to $1,925 with an average price of $1,379.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om French Camp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in French Camp ranges from $720 to $2,309 with an average monthly rent of $1,747.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in French Camp c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in French Camp range from $1,050 to $3,195.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,226.
How expensive are French Camp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 18 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in French Camp on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,625 to $3,545 - averaging $3,207 for the location.
